The Framework for Leading With Both Care and Accountability

from The Curiosity Shop with Brené Brown and Adam Grant · host Vox Media Podcast Network

This episode is a master class in coaching as Aiko Bethea, one of the most respected senior leadership coaches in the country, takes Brené through a current leadership conflict in real time, showing just how hard it is to slow down and lead from your values instead of your urgency. The coaching session is underpinned by Aiko's new "Anchored, Aligned, and Accountable" framework that focuses on why self-leadership is so critical in today's complex operating environment. Together, they dig into the difference between assuming good intent and believing someone is doing the best they can, and why that distinction changes what accountability actually looks like in practice. Aiko also introduces and models the powerful coaching practice of "three levels of listening" and how it's central to developing a coaching mindset.
